About the "Perimeter" Worksheet
Perimeter is an advanced geometry worksheet that challenges students to apply their knowledge of both perimeter and area in complex problem-solving scenarios. This interactive and printable worksheet presents three distinct problems that require different approaches and skills. The first problem asks students to determine the width of Sarah's bedroom given its length and total area, introducing the concept of working backwards from area to find a missing dimension. The second problem involves calculating the area of an irregularly shaped figure composed of rectangles. The third problem requires students to find a missing side length of a hallway using its perimeter.
This worksheet goes beyond basic calculations by incorporating multi-step problem-solving and critical thinking skills. Students must interpret given information, choose appropriate formulas, and perform accurate calculations while dealing with different units of measurement. The use of real-world contexts, such as bedrooms and hallways, helps students connect abstract mathematical concepts to practical situations. By combining area and perimeter problems, the worksheet encourages students to deepen their understanding of these related but distinct concepts.
